## Deployment

PickPath Optimizer ships as a single container and rolls out via the Lanternview release pipeline. Drain the worker queue before swapping images, then verify the route-scoring endpoint returns healthy. Rollbacks are safe at any point before the first pick wave. The service reads the following configuration at startup:

deployment values, kajep-kageg:
[praix]
host = praix.paliqcorp.corp
user = praix_svc
database = praix_prod

Welcome to the support rotation for Echowalk, our audio-guide app for the Brindlemoor Museum network! Most tickets are about tours not downloading over spotty gallery Wi-Fi — walk visitors through airplane-mode toggling first, it fixes 80% of cases. Anything involving missing audio tracks or corrupted tour bundles should go straight to the content team. Escalate those cases to the address below.

escalation mailbox, yajeg-bageg: quenax.olidor@lumiccorp.internal

# Handover: Bramblekit SDKs

Parity status: the Ryelock SDK (Go) now matches the Tinwhistle SDK (JS) except for batch uploads — tracked, low priority. Plugin authors: target the shared spec, not either SDK directly. Test fixtures live in the parity harness repo. To decrypt the harness snapshot bundle, unseal it with the recovery passphrase that follows.

vault phrase of yawig-bawig = fenael-norael-eliox-gilox-casath-druath-zorys-istwyn-jorwyn